A BRISTOL DELFT POLYCHROME DISH painted in iron-red, yellow, blue and green with birds perched on rockwork, birds and insects in flight among scrolling flower-sprays and with a stylised pagoda within a double-line border, the reverse with circle and dash ornament (minute rim chip and glaze flaking to rim), circa 1730
36.5cm. diam.
